Output deaf3990885082f03b5c28f65db204bcb8459f41ddf3931d89ded209af5b3ba2:0

value
20155
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3aaf24dfd3b55fa9beb9808a0f051bfa7a684ce OP_EQUAL
address
3J51fTCscbSNrgTJ5MRsNcVL39qK8T8WEU
transaction
deaf3990885082f03b5c28f65db204bcb8459f41ddf3931d89ded209af5b3ba2
confirmations
182393
spent
true